Okay, so check this out — crypto used to feel like the Wild West. Whoa! It still kinda does. But the stakes are different now: users move assets across chains, dApps composability is insane, and bad actors have grown very very sophisticated. My instinct said “we’re overdue for smarter wallets,” and honestly, something felt off about wallets that treat cross‑chain as an afterthought.
Let me be blunt. Multi‑chain convenience without rigorous security is a recipe for disaster. Seriously? Yes. Initially I thought that hardware keys plus a seed phrase were enough, but then I watched a front‑running exploit drain liquidity pools because the wallet leaked mempool info. On one hand, UX drove adoption; on the other, we opened up new attack surfaces that were ignored for too long. This is not hypothetical — real value moves fast, and MEV hunters move faster.
Short version: your wallet must think like an adversary. Here’s the thing. It should prevent private data leaks. It should reduce exposure to sandwich and frontrunning bots. It should give you control of signing strategy across chains. Hmm… easier said than done. But that’s where modern wallet design gets interesting.

Multi‑Chain Complexity: Why It Breaks Old Assumptions
Transfers across chains introduce more than routing headaches. Wow! Cross‑chain bridges, relayers, and wrapped assets increase the attack surface. Medium‑term, the average user doesn’t track nonce handling, gas strategies, or mempool visibility — yet those details dictate whether a transaction survives intact. Long explanations are possible, but the short takeaway is: every additional chain is a multiplier for risk, not just convenience.
I’ll be honest: I used to dismiss some of these risks as edge cases. Actually, wait — let me rephrase that. They are edge cases until they aren’t. One failed bridge or one improperly signed batch can cascade badly. On the other hand, well‑designed multi‑chain wallets can reduce that cascade by normalizing security logic across protocols and presenting a consistent mental model to users.
Designing for multi‑chain means thinking about signature abstraction, transaction simulation, and safe defaults. My gut reaction when testing wallets is often “show me the simulation first.” And many modern wallets now do exactly that — simulate trades, estimate slippage, and warn about reentrancy or suspicious gas spikes. But simulation isn’t enough if the wallet leaks pending tx data to the network.
MEV: The Invisible Tax on Every Trader
MEV isn’t some esoteric phenomenon limited to miners. Really. Maximal Extractable Value affects anyone sending transactions that touch liquidity. Short sentence. Bots monitor mempools, reorder transactions, and squeeze profit out of tiny slippage windows. So even a 0.3% trade can become 3% in the wrong environment. This part bugs me. It’s systemic.
On one hand, MEV can be a natural market force. On the other, it can be predatory. Initially I thought that encryption or delaying broadcast would solve it, but then I learned about subtle tradeoffs: delay too much, you miss the market; broadcast too early, you leak intent. There’s no perfect neutral yet, though some hybrid solutions look promising.
Wallets should adopt MEV‑aware signing flows. They should offer private relay options, batch signing, and front‑running resistant heuristics where possible. My experience says those features belong in the UX, not tucked away under advanced menus. Users need clear choices so they can pick speed, privacy, or cost — not guess.
What Real MEV Protection Looks Like
Short answer: it’s layered. Really. You want several defenses working together. First, keep mempool exposure minimal. Second, use private relays or commit‑reveal schemes for sensitive ops. Third, let the wallet simulate and optionally reorder internal operations to avoid obvious sandwich patterns. Long sentence here to show the complexity that rests beneath a simple “Send” button — because the real work happens in how wallets prepare and broadcast transactions, how they sign them, and how they integrate third‑party services without compromising keys.
I’ve tested wallets that integrate MEV relays, and the difference is palpable. Transactions either complete closer to their expected price, or they get pushed through without being slashed by bot activity. Still, not all relays are equivalent. Some add latency. Some require trust. So choose carefully.
Usability vs Security — The Real Tradeoff
People often say security is a UX problem. Hmm… that’s true and also incomplete. Security is a product problem. You can have both, but you must prioritize certain flows. Short note. For example, prompting users with cryptic gas settings is worse than offering sane defaults with an escape hatch. Users want reassurance more than they want raw technical detail. But they also deserve transparency.
On the development side, wallets should adopt hardened signing APIs, support EIP‑712 for structured data, and isolate critical keys with hardware‑style protections even on software wallets. My instinct says that a wallet that pretends to be both “light and fully secure” is lying by omission. Be explicit about tradeoffs.
By the way, if you’re exploring practical options, check out rabby wallet — I’ve used it across multiple chains and it balances a power‑user feature set with pragmatic security defaults. It’s not perfect, but it shows how a wallet can be designed for multi‑chain realities without drowning the user in options.
Operational Best Practices for Users
Quick tips. Seriously. Use multiple accounts for different risk profiles. Short. Keep a hot wallet for trading and a cold wallet for long‑term holdings. Simulate big trades before executing. Use limit orders where possible to avoid slippage exploitation. Avoid approving unlimited allowances. And yes, read the permission you’re signing — I know, boring, but effective.
For teams: integrate transaction monitoring, set up automated alerts for abnormal activity, and consider multisig for treasury management. On one hand, multisig adds friction. On the other, it prevents single points of failure. Tradeoffs again. But they’re worth it when you’re protecting real capital.
FAQ
How does a wallet reduce mempool leaks?
By using private relays, delaying broadcast until signed transactions are batched, or employing commit‑reveal patterns. Some wallets offer optional private RPCs that minimize public mempool exposure; others integrate MEV relays to route sensitive txs through protected channels.
Is MEV avoidable?
Not completely. But it can be mitigated. Private relays, transaction batching, and careful order sizing reduce the surface area. Also, adopting wallets that simulate expected outcomes before broadcasting helps avoid obvious traps.
Should I switch wallets if I use many chains?
If your current wallet treats chains as separate silos and lacks advanced signing or MEV protections, then yes: consider a wallet built around multi‑chain logic. Look for features like cross‑chain address management, transaction simulation, and integrations with private relays.
